Improve meson_gxbb_wdt driver
Source: https://lore.kernel.org/linux-watchdog/5229d62c-b327-254f-800f-1524f27491b3@roeck-us.net/T/
Remade using all suggestions from Guenter
* Added nowayout module parameter
* Added timeout module parameter
* Removed watchdog_stop_on_reboot (I feel that it is important to keep
the watchdog running during the reboot sequence, in the event that an
abnormal driver freezes the reboot process. This is my personal opinion
and I hope the driver authors will agree with my proposal, if not just
ignore this last commit)
